The Story Behind Spam Musubi
Spam musubi is pure post-WWII Hawai'i fusion. Spam arrived during the war, when fresh meat was rationed and the U.S. military shipped canned meat by the trainload to feed troops and the local population. Japanese-Hawaiians, already making rice musubi (omusubi) at home, paired the two — a slice of grilled Spam over shoyu-glazed rice, wrapped in nori like sushi. By the 1980s it was the official 7-Eleven local snack, the lunchbox staple, the surf-trip breakfast. Hawai'i still consumes more Spam per capita than any state in the U.S.
